Tata Advanced Systems Limited Selects Ramco Systems to Strengthen Defence MRO Operations for C130J Super Hercules

Introduction of Advanced Aviation Software

Bengaluru / Chennai, INDIA – Ramco Systems, a global leader in aviation software, has announced its partnership with Tata Advanced Systems Limited (TASL) to implement next-generation Aviation Software at TASL’s new Defence MRO facility. This facility will focus on the maintenance of Lockheed Martin’s C130J Super Hercules aircraft for the Indian Air Force, marking a significant advancement in TASL’s commitment to creating a modern, technology-driven MRO ecosystem.

Comprehensive MRO Platform Deployment

As part of this initiative, Ramco will deploy its integrated Aviation MRO platform across TASL’s operations. This platform encompasses a wide range of capabilities, including Contract and Quote Management, Maintenance Planning, Hangar and Component Maintenance, Supply Chain Management, Engineering and Quality, as well as Customer Billing. The digital infrastructure will be further enhanced by Ramco’s advanced solutions, which include Anywhere mobile applications, E-Publications, Digital Task Cards, and resource planning tools. These features will facilitate real-time access to operational data across various functions within the facility.

Vision for a Digital MRO Ecosystem

The selection of Ramco Systems highlights TASL’s forward-thinking approach towards digital MRO operations. TASL aims to implement end-to-end digital processing of customer work packages, achieving a fully digital shop floor supported by modern mobile applications and integrated OEM documentation management. This ecosystem will seamlessly interface with TASL’s existing ERP system. Ramco’s technology is expected to serve as the backbone for these objectives, promoting automation, standardization, and clarity in operational workflows.

Expected Benefits and Operational Enhancements

Through this implementation, TASL will gain a unified system designed to improve visibility, streamline execution, and optimize the use of manpower, materials, and tools. The transformation is anticipated to yield measurable improvements in efficiency and turnaround times, while also establishing a foundation for future scalability and long-term growth.

Overview of Tata Advanced Systems Limited

Tata Advanced Systems Limited (TASL), a wholly owned subsidiary of Tata Sons, is a prominent player in India’s Aerospace and Defence sector. Established as the strategic aerospace and defence arm of the Tata Group, TASL provides integrated solutions across various domains, including Aerostructures, Aeroengines, Defence and Security, Unmanned Aerial Systems, and Maintenance, Repair, and Overhaul (MRO).

TASL collaborates with global OEMs and technology leaders to deliver products and services that adhere to stringent international quality and regulatory standards. With state-of-the-art manufacturing facilities and engineering centers throughout India, TASL supports both domestic and international customers, significantly contributing to India’s vision of self-reliance in defense manufacturing.
